How do we best access Taman Nasional Kutai from Hotel Bunga Liany, and what unique wildlife should we look for?
From Hotel Bunga Liany, we typically arrange local transport to the park's Sangkima or Prevab research station entrances, which are your gateways to the forest. Beyond the iconic wild orangutans, we love searching for proboscis monkeys along the riverbanks and the elusive sun bears.
